Chinese cartoon lands on international market

"Xi Yangyang and Hui Tailang", a popular Chinese made cartoon TV series, landed on international market on July 5, 2009, China Radio International reports.

The over 500-episode hot cartoon, which has been dominating Chinese market over four years, will gain international attention by landing in 13 Asian countries and regions the coming Sunday.

With the inspiration of images originated from Chinese culture, the cartoon tells the stories between a sheep family and a wolf family. The struggle between the two families was demonstrated in a very casual and humorous way. It not only conveys intense conflicts between the two groups of animals but also reflect some current hot topics that people are concerned with.

The cartoon series with humor and wisdom are not only welcomed by kids but also by young people. An online survey shows that over sixty percent of white-collar workers love them and consider the series a good way to reduce pressure.

Experts estimated that the demand of Chinese-made cartoons is 250 thousand minutes per year, which is twice as much as the current production ability.
